Hi from the east canada


hey all,

i'm from montreal, always love listening and feel music since i was young. i started getting serious in the audio department and learned ALOT with car audio. unfortunalty, in september i got rid of the car and got a smaller car not worth installing audio equipment in, so I went ahead and got into home audio/ HT.

gotta have a system somewhere ! hehe

well. heres a little evolution of what a had/have.

my first real sub setup( aa arsenal 15" in 3.8NET @30hz with 67.5sq.inch):
sounded really flat, deep but dindt pass the 140s db sticked around 138-139, on music






my second sub setup( aa havoc 18" in 4.2NET @36hz with 73sq.inch):
was loud enough, snappy , sounded crisp and had some nice punch and lows but no low end extension like my first setup, but still sounded very good.







my third and last setup( 2 tc-10oem 10", each in 1.55cu.ftNET @40hz with39sq.inch )
even louder than both first and second setup, monster lows, LOT of excursion, noticeably lot louder and sounded very deep, yet, good and very controlled.
